Across TCGA patient cohorts, HOXD1 mutation is significantly associated with the total protein of many other genes, with 16 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ible HOXD1-associated genes across cancer lineages are EGFR_pY1068, FoxM1, and PDCD4. Each is linked with HOXD1 in more than 1 cancer types. Because this analysis shows association rather than direction, both HOXD1-to-partner and partner-to-HOXD1 results are reported.
